Bhutto-Related Scheduling Changes at CNN

By SteveK 

Several scheduling changes will take place in primetime for CNN tonight, in the wake of the assassination of former Pakistan Prime Minister Benazir Bhutto.

Wolf Blitzer will be back at 8pmET with another hour of The Situation Room. He will be followed by Larry King Live and Anderson Cooper 360, as regularly scheduled.

Then at 11pmET, CNN will air a one-hour documentary entitled “CNN Special Investigations Unit — Pakistan: Terror Central.” Correspondent Nic Robertson reported in the documentary on the terrorist operations by al Qaeda and the Taliban in Pakistan. The special looks into the politics of Pakistani President Pervez Musharraf, how he is fighting the War on Terror and if he is playing both sides.
